walking in the Rain with My Korean Spouse

Korean Rainy Night of Love 

When I first met my love
My Korean bride in 1982.

We would go for long walks
Often ending with dinner.

After a romantic walk 
In the rained
Soaked streets.

As we sat down
At the restaurant 
Enjoying a dinner date.
 

We looked at the menu
Under the ruby red lights


Of the pub.

And fell in love
Every moment
Looking at each other.

With love blazing
From our eyes.
Sparks flew from heart to heart. 

It was love 
At first sight


Forging a deep 
Lasting emotional connections.

As we fell deeply
Under each other’s love spell.

The mojo clearly
 Working overtime
As Cupid’s arrow struck home.

During the course 
Of the magical evening.
